CVE-2023-51539

WordPress Apollo13 Framework Extensions Plugin <= 1.9.1 is vulnerable to Cross Site Request Forgery (CSRF)

Apollo13 Framework Extensions <= 1.9.1 - Cross-Site Request Forgery

Cross-Site Request Forgery (CSRF) vulnerability in Apollo13Themes Apollo13 Framework Extensions.This issue affects Apollo13 Framework Extensions: from n/a through 1.9.1.
Mögliche Gegenmaßnahme
Apollo13 Framework Extensions: Update to version 1.9.2, or a newer patched version

CWE-352 Cross-Site Request Forgery (CSRF)

The web application does not, or can not, sufficiently verify whether a well-formed, valid, consistent request was intentionally provided by the user who submitted the request.
